Serious Sam II for the PC offers an impressive upgrade in graphics and gameplay compared to its predecessor. Thanks to the second-generation Serious Engine, developed by Croteam, characters are now brought to life with over 100 times more detail. The result is an immersive experience, where players can explore vast and vibrant environments teeming with even more eccentric enemies.
One of the standout features of Serious Sam II is the absence of compromise. Despite the improved visuals and larger-than-life enemies, the gameplay remains true to its roots, delivering the same adrenaline-pumping action that made the first Serious Sam a hit. This dedication to preserving the essence of the series is commendable, as the game manages to capture the nostalgic feel that fans of classic shooters crave.
The ability to witness record-breaking enemy counts on screen simultaneously is a testament to the power of the new engine. This aspect alone adds to the excitement and chaos that is a trademark of the Serious Sam series. Players will find themselves besieged by hordes of adversaries, forcing them to rely on their reflexes and quick thinking to survive.
